Summary of the contracting process

Homes England intends to procure demolition and associated enabling works at the former Halfway House Primary School, Queenborough Road, Minster-on-Sea, Isle of Sheppey. The works category is demolition, including site establishment, mobilisation, security, soft stripping and demolition of the existing school buildings, structures and infrastructure to ground-level slabs. The scope also covers lawful removal and disposal of asbestos-containing materials, protection and management of private services, ecological controls including bat mitigation, processing and recycling of demolition waste, environmental monitoring, site clearance and preparation for future redevelopment. The contractor will provide completion records, waste documentation, statutory compliance records and handover information. Delivery is at the former school site on the Isle of Sheppey, Kent.

This procurement is at the planning stage: Homes England has stated an intention to procure, but has not issued an invitation to tender. The expected procedure is to appoint a contractor through a single-lot works procurement, with the lot identified as suitable for SMEs. The estimated value is £1,000,000 excluding VAT (£1,200,000 including VAT). The buyer’s indicative contract period is 4 January 2027 to 30 April 2027, and the next notice is expected on 12 October 2026. Preliminary market engagement includes a short questionnaire, with responses expected by 27 August 2026 at 13:00. Dates and values are indicative and may change. The works are expected to use the NEC3 Engineering and Construction Contract, Option A.

This will suit demolition contractors with experience safely clearing former institutional or comparable developed sites and managing enabling works through to a development-ready parcel. Relevant capability includes soft stripping, building and infrastructure demolition, asbestos identification, removal and lawful disposal, independent asbestos verification and monitoring, and the segregation, recycling and disposal of demolition arisings. Suppliers will need to manage private services, dust, noise and vibration, environmental controls, ecological constraints and protected-species mitigation. Compliance with health and safety legislation, statutory requirements and planning conditions will be important, including requirements arising from the Prior Approval process. Contractors should also be able to deliver completion, waste, compliance and handover records under an NEC3 Engineering and Construction Contract, Option A. The procurement is identified as suitable for SMEs.

Notice Description

Homes England intends to appoint a suitably qualified and experienced contractor to undertake the demolition and associated enabling works at the former Halfway Houses Primary School, Queenborough Road, Minster-On-Sea, Isle of Sheppey ME12 2BE. The scope of works is anticipated to include * Site establishment, mobilisation and security arrangements. * Soft strip of existing school buildings and structures. * Identification, removal and lawful disposal of asbestos-containing materials, including independent verification and monitoring requirements. * Demolition of all existing buildings (B1-B7, B9 and B10), structures and associated infrastructure to ground level floor slabs. * Protection, isolation and management of existing private services. * Management of ecological constraints, including compliance with protected species (bat) mitigation measures and site-specific ecological requirements. * Processing, segregation, recycling and disposal of demolition arisings and waste materials. * Environmental monitoring and control measures, including dust, noise and vibration. * Site clearance and preparation of the site for future redevelopment. * Provision of all completion records, waste documentation, statutory compliance records and handover information required under the contract. The successful contractor will be required to undertake the works in accordance with all relevant statutory requirements, health and safety legislation, environmental controls, ecological constraints and the requirements of the NEC3 Engineering and Construction Contract (Option A). At the time the procurement documentation was prepared, the application remained under consideration by the Local Planning Authority. Tenderers will be expected to comply with any planning conditions, mitigation measures or statutory requirements arising from the Prior Approval process. The principal objective is to safely demolish the former school, remove asbestos-containing materials, clear the site and deliver a development-ready parcel of land to facilitate Homes England's future redevelopment aspirations for the site.
